What is the Monthly Return of Equity Issuer on Movements in Securities?

The Monthly Return of Equity Issuer on Movements in Securities is a regulatory form required for companies listed on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ange. This form serves a significant purpose by detailing the movements in share capital, which includes ordinary shares, preference shares, and other types of stock. The completion of this form is critical for compliance with regulatory requirements enforced by Hong Kong Exchanges and Clearing Limited.
Regulatory filings like this ensure transparency in the market and hold companies accountable for their reported capital changes. Movements in share capital can affect both the valuation of a company and stakeholder confidence.

When and How to Submit the Monthly Return of Equity Issuer on Movements in Securities

Submission of the Monthly Return is governed by strict deadlines to ensure timely reporting. Companies must adhere to the following:
  • File the return by the end of the month following the reporting period.
  • Utilize available submission methods, including online platforms or mail.
  • Keep track of submissions to confirm successful filing and compliance.
Awareness of deadlines and proper submission procedures can prevent late fees and ensure regulatory compliance.
